When booking an airport shuttle, be sure to check the time of day and the cost. Some companies charge extra if you fly in after 10 PM or before 6 AM. Those that don’t have a reservation may have to wait for a longer time than usual. So if you’re flying during these times, check out the times when most flights arrive and depart. Kansas City is the largest city in Missouri. It is often referred to as the “City of Fountains” because of its large number of fountains. The city’s airport is conveniently located fifteen miles from downtown and close to shopping, dining, and lodging.
